k-NN search. What is the difference between these 2-codes ?

The program for k-NN search in MATLAB.
load fisheriris %inbuilt data set provided in MATLAB.
x = meas(:,3:4);
gscatter(x(:,1),x(:,2),species)
set(legend,'location','best')
newpoint = [5 1.45];
line(newpoint(1),newpoint(2),'marker','x','color','k',...
'markersize',10,'linewidth',2)
[n,d] = knnsearch(x,newpoint,'k',10) %my doubt is here.
line(x(n,1),x(n,2),'color',[.5 .5 .5],'marker','o',...
'linestyle','none','markersize',10)
%modified program for my requirement with different data set. x and z are the two variables with 24 elements in each.
load stroke
gscatter(x,z,species);
set(legend,'location','best')
newpoint=[115,150];
line(newpoint(1),newpoint(2),'marker','x','co lor','k',...
'markersize',10,'linewidth',2);
[n,d] = knnsearch(x,newpoint,'k',10) % when i run , it gives error here. what is the difference between the original code and modified code ? infact 'newpoint' in the original program is a vector.
line(x(n,1),x(n,2),'color',[.5 .5 .5],'marker','o',...
'linestyle','none','markersize',10)

Accepted Answer

Tom Lane
Tom Lane on 15 Feb 2012
You have supplied only x, not [x z], as the first argument to knnsearch. Your newpoint vector, on the other hand, has two columns.
